LOW-FAT TURKEY MEATLOAF



Low-Fat Turkey Meatloaf image

Fat free ground turkey and lean ground pork meatloaf. Very low in fat and high in protein. I have calculated the nutritional values and this recipe is much lower in fat and cholesterol than the final recipe indicates. Be sure that the ground pork is very lean or use all turkey and more seasonings.

Provided by SheriO

Categories     Pork

Time 55m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 lb ground turkey breast, 99% fat free
1 lb ground lean pork
1 teaspoon dried onion flakes or 1/4 raw onion, chopped
1/4 cup grated parmesan cheese
1/2 cup Italian seasoned breadcrumbs
2 eggs
1/4 cup fat-free half-and-half
1/4 teaspoon garlic salt
pepper, if desired
catsup, for topping

Steps:

  • mix all ingredients well in large bowl.
  • Pat into bread loaf pan.
  • Top with drizzle of catsup.
  • Bake at 350ยบ for 45-60 minutes.
  • lean bulk pork sausage can be substituted, but it should be very lean.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 370.4, Fat 20, SaturatedFat 7.6, Cholesterol 167.7, Sodium 357.5, Carbohydrate 8.3, Fiber 0.5, Sugar 1.3, Protein 36.8

CAJUN TURKEY MEATLOAF (LOW FAT) HUBBIE'S FAVORITE



Cajun Turkey Meatloaf (Low Fat) Hubbie's Favorite image

A healthy version of meatloaf that does not sacrifice the taste for a healthy alternative! Leftovers are great on onion rolls with lettuce and tomato for a great sandwich treat. Your can use either Creole or Cajun seasoning. I've been making this for years, and I can't remember where I got it. Sometimes, I put slices of pancetta (or bacon) on the outside. Of course, it isn't as healthy - but it sure is pretty and tastes great.

Provided by Jb Tyler

Categories     Poultry

Time 1h10m

Yield 8 slices, 8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 1/2 lbs ground turkey
1 large onion, chopped
3 large garlic cloves, chopped
1/2 cup fresh breadcrumb
1/2 cup chopped fresh parsley
2 tablespoons creole seasoning
1 egg white, whisked
2 teaspoons ground cumin
1 teaspoon dried thyme, crumbled
2 tablespoons spicy mustard

Steps:

  • Preheat over to 350 degrees F.
  • Combine first 9 ingredients in large bowl. Season with salt (remember that the creole or cajun seasoning can be salty) and pepper. Place turkey mixture in 9x5-inch nonstick loaf pan. Cover and bake 20 minutes. Remove from oven, and spread top with mustard. Bank uncovered another 35 minutes. Let stand 10 minutes. Remove from pan and cut into slices.

Tips:

  • Use ground turkey breast for a leaner meatloaf.
  • Add vegetables, such as carrots, celery, and onions, to the meatloaf mixture for added flavor and nutrition.
  • Use a mixture of bread crumbs and oats to help bind the meatloaf mixture together.
  • Season the meatloaf generously with herbs and spices, such as garlic, onion, and thyme.
  • Bake the meatloaf in a loaf pan at 350 degrees Fahrenheit for about an hour, or until a meat thermometer inserted into the center reads 165 degrees Fahrenheit.
  • Let the meatloaf cool for 10-15 minutes before slicing and serving.
